閸忔娊妫�
80KM婢跺洣鍞ゆ潪顖欐
閼奉亜濮╂径鍥﹀敜閿涘苯鐣鹃弮璺侯槵娴狅拷
鐠佲晙缍橀惃鍕殶閹诡喗妗堟稉宥勬丢婢讹拷

VMware 000001 VMDK文件解析指南
vmware 000001 vmdk

首页 2024-12-27 02:09:57



深入解析VMware 000001 VMDK文件:虚拟化存储的核心 在虚拟化技术的浪潮中,VMware以其强大的功能和灵活性,成为了众多企业和数据中心的首选

    而VMDK(Virtual Machine Disk)文件,作为VMware虚拟化环境中虚拟机存储的核心组件,承载着虚拟机操作系统、应用程序及数据的关键信息
推荐工具:虚拟机批量链接

    本文将深入探讨“vmware 000001 vmdk”文件,揭示其在虚拟化存储中的关键作用、工作原理、性能优化以及日常管理维护的要点
推荐工具:一键修改远程端口(IIS7服务器助手)

     一、VMDK文件简介 VMDK文件是VMware虚拟机磁盘文件的扩展名,它代表了虚拟机所使用的虚拟硬盘
推荐工具:远程桌面批量管理工具

    在创建虚拟机时,VMware会为每个虚拟机分配一个或多个VMDK文件,用于存储该虚拟机的所有磁盘数据
推荐链接:海外服务器、国外vps

    这些文件通常保存在虚拟机的配置文件目录中,而“000001.vmdk”通常是主磁盘文件,包含了操作系统的启动分区、系统文件及用户数据等关键内容

     二、VMDK文件的工作机制 2.1 磁盘格式与结构 VMDK文件遵循特定的磁盘格式标准,包括稀疏(Sparse)和预分配(Preallocated)两种类型

    稀疏格式的文件只占用实际使用的磁盘空间,剩余空间保持空闲状态,适用于需要动态调整磁盘大小的场景

    而预分配格式则在创建时即分配全部指定空间,保证了磁盘性能的稳定性,但会占用更多的物理存储空间

     每个VMDK文件由描述文件(.vmdk)和可能存在的元数据文件(如-flat.vmdk或-delta.vmdk)组成

    描述文件包含了虚拟磁盘的元数据,如大小、布局、快照信息等;而元数据文件则直接存储了虚拟机的磁盘数据

     2.2 数据访问与存储 当虚拟机运行时,VMware通过VMDK文件与虚拟机之间进行数据交换

    读写操作首先由虚拟机操作系统发起,经由VMware虚拟化层,最终映射到物理存储上的VMDK文件

    这一过程中,VMware的存储虚拟化技术起到了关键作用,它实现了对不同物理存储设备的抽象和整合,为虚拟机提供了统一、高效的存储访问接口

     三、VMDK文件的性能优化 3.1 存储配置 优化VMDK文件性能的第一步是合理配置存储资源

    这包括选择合适的存储硬件(如SSD或高性能HDD)、使用RAID阵列以提高数据读写速度和容错能力,以及合理配置存储控制器和缓存策略

     3.2 磁盘类型选择 根据虚拟机的应用需求和性能要求,选择合适的VMDK磁盘类型也至关重要

    例如,对于需要频繁读写操作的应用,采用厚置备延迟置零(Thick Provisioned Lazy Zeroed)或厚置备立即置零(Thick Provisioned Eager Zeroed)的磁盘类型可以提供更好的性能保障;而对于存储空间有限且磁盘使用率不高的场景,则可选择薄置备(Thin Provisioned)磁盘类型以节省空间

     3.3 快照管理 虽然快照功能为虚拟机提供了便捷的备份和恢复手段,但过多的快照会增加VMDK文件的复杂性和管理难度,甚至影响虚拟机性能

    因此,定期清理不再需要的快照,合理规划快照策略,是保持VMDK文件高效运行的重要措施

     四、VMDK文件的日常管理维护 4.1 备份与恢复 定期对VMDK文件进行备份是保障数据安全的关键

    VMware提供了多种备份解决方案,如vSphere Data Protection(VDP)、第三方备份软件等,可以帮助用户实现自动化的备份作业和灾难恢复计划

     4.2 磁盘扩容与迁移 随着虚拟机应用的增长,可能需要对VMDK文件进行扩容

    VMware提供了简便的扩容工具,允许管理员在不中断虚拟机运行的情况下增加磁盘容量

    此外,当需要将虚拟机迁移到新的存储环境时,VMware的Storage vMotion功能可以实现无缝迁移,确保数据的完整性和业务的连续性

     4.3 监控与故障排查 对VMDK文件的性能和健康状况进行持续监控是预防故障、提高系统稳定性的有效手段

    VMware vCenter Server提供了丰富的监控工具和报警机制,可以帮助管理员及时发现并解决存储性能瓶颈、磁盘错误等问题

     五、结语 综上所述,“vmware 000001 vmdk”文件作为VMware虚拟化环境中不可或缺的组成部分,其重要性不言而喻

    通过深入理解VMDK文件的工作原理、实施有效的性能优化策略以及科学的日常管理维护,可以显著提升虚拟机的运行效率和数据安全性,为企业的数字化转型和业务创新提供坚实的支撑

     随着虚拟化技术的不断演进和存储技术的飞速发展,未来VMDK文件的管理和优化将更加注重智能化、自动化和安全性,为构建更加高效、灵活、可靠的虚拟化存储体系奠定坚实基础

    因此,作为虚拟化技术的实践者和推动者,我们应持续关注VMDK文件及相关技术的发展动态,不断提升自身的专业技能和管理水平,以适应不断变化的市场需求和技术挑战